2023 Buick Encore GX Reviews Summary

General Motors has big plans for Buick. The near-luxury division positioned between Chevrolet and Cadillac is slated to go all-electric by the end of the decade, with a fresh lineup of EVs highlighted by a new design language. But those new models aren’t scheduled to arrive for a few more years, so for now Buick carries on with a lineup of conventional gasoline crossover SUVs, of which the 2023 Buick Encore GX is the entry-level option.

The Encore GX was launched for the 2020 model year as a larger sibling to the Buick Encore, but the standard Encore is being discontinued, leaving only the GX for 2023. It slots below the Envision and Enclave in Buick’s three-model crossover lineup.

While Buick is generally considered a step up from mainstream brands, the Encore GX’s size and pricing are more in line with subcompact SUVs from mainstream brands, such as the Hyundai Kona and Mazda CX-30, or the lifted-hatchback Subaru Crosstrek. In fact, the Encore GX shares powertrains and a basic platform with one of these vehicles—the Chevrolet Trailblazer.

The only change for 2023 is a new extra-cost Moonstone Gray Metallic paint option. That means the lineup still consists of base Preferred, mid-level Select, and top Essence trim levels. We tested out an Encore GX Essence for this review.

2024 Toyota Sienna Reviews Summary

Now in its fourth generation, the latest family hauler is offered only as a fuel-sipping hybrid model with three rows of seating and power sliding doors. Plus the Sienna comes standard with plenty of safety features and it’s comfy to boot. Why even both with an SUV?

Verdict: The 2024 Toyota Sienna delivers impressive fuel efficiency, thanks to its standard hybrid engine. Toyota also offers optional all-wheel drive, and many shoppers may appreciate the Sienna's dramatic exterior styling. Performance, while efficient, isn't thrilling, and the Sienna's tech is looking a bit outdated. Otherwise, this minivan delivers great value.

Look and feel

2023 Buick Encore GX

5/10

2024 Toyota Sienna

8/10

The 2023 Buick Encore GX, despite Buick's storied design history, did not carry forward any of the brand's classic styling cues. The vehicle's rounded exterior and tall stance resulted in awkward proportions that failed to capture the high-riding SUV look popular in the market. Even with the optional Sport Touring Package, which included different bumpers, a black mesh grille with red inserts, and 18-inch wheels, the changes were subtle and barely noticeable without a direct comparison to a standard model.

Inside, the Encore GX Essence trim offered expected features like leather upholstery, dual-zone climate control, and power-adjustable seats. However, the interior was dominated by plastic materials, reminding us of its position at the bottom of Buick's lineup. The fit and finish were commendable, but the design was uninspired, with a blob-like dashboard and door panels reminiscent of 1990s automotive design. The instrument cluster, with its two round binnacles and small digital display, was the only standout feature.

The 2024 Toyota Sienna, available in multiple trims including LE, XLE, XSE, Woodland Edition, Limited, and Platinum, presented a distinctive look. The minivan featured sleek front and rear fascias and came in vibrant colors like deep blue, red, and green. LED lighting was standard, with upper trims boasting Bi-LED projector headlamps. The XSE trim, with its black metallic mesh grille, black heated side mirrors, and 20-inch dark wheels, added a sporty touch.

The Woodland Edition, designed for a bit more off-road capability, included roof rails with crossbars, a tow hitch, and slightly increased ground clearance. Inside, the Sienna offered cloth seats, three-zone climate control, and room for eight passengers. The XSE trim with the optional Premium package replaced the second-row bench with captain's chairs and added heated and cooled leather-trimmed front seats. The interior design featured horizontal lines for a spacious feel, a fixed center console with satin accents, and easily accessible cup holders and shifter. Upper trims even included a built-in vacuum cleaner.

Performance

2023 Buick Encore GX

5/10

2024 Toyota Sienna

6/10

The 2023 Buick Encore GX offered two turbocharged three-cylinder engines. The standard 1.2-liter engine produced 137 horsepower and 162 pound-feet of torque, while the optional 1.3-liter engine delivered 155 hp and 174 lb-ft of torque. Front-wheel drive was standard, with all-wheel drive available for the 1.3-liter engine. The FWD models used a continuously variable transmission (CVT), while AWD models featured a nine-speed automatic transmission.

Our 1.3-liter AWD test car provided stronger acceleration than expected, but power delivery was not smooth, requiring patience to get the most out of the engine. The ride was comfortable, and the cabin was quiet, thanks to Buick's Quiet Tuning package. However, the Encore GX felt ponderous and awkward, with slow and lifeless steering and significant body roll.

The 2024 Toyota Sienna, a hybrid minivan, combined a 2.5-liter four-cylinder engine with two electric motors, producing a total of 245 horsepower. AWD models added an electric motor for the rear wheels. Despite the sport-tuned suspension and Sport mode, the Sienna felt sluggish off the line, and the CVT did not enhance the driving experience. Acceleration was smooth but slow, especially when merging on highways or climbing hills.

Around town, the Sienna provided a pleasant, if unremarkable, driving experience. Normal or Eco mode was best for city driving, with an EV mode for slow-speed areas. The brakes were a bit grabby, but the steering was light and accurate, and visibility was excellent. For those seeking more driving pleasure, other minivans like the Honda Odyssey, Kia Carnival, or Chrysler Pacifica offered stronger V6 engines.

Form and function

2023 Buick Encore GX

7/10

2024 Toyota Sienna

8/10

The 2023 Buick Encore GX offered competitive passenger space, with headroom comparable to rivals like the Hyundai Kona, Mazda CX-30, and Subaru Crosstrek. However, the Subaru provided more front legroom, and the Kia Seltos offered more rear legroom and cargo space. The Encore GX had 23.5 cubic feet of cargo space with the rear seats up and 50.2 cubic feet with them folded.

The front seats were placed close together, reducing the feeling of spaciousness, and lacked thigh support. However, the Encore GX made good use of available space for small-item storage, with large door pockets and a space-efficient wireless phone charger. The instrumentation was well-executed, with clear information displays and an array of hard buttons for ease of use.

The 2024 Toyota Sienna excelled in interior space and functionality. The front storage pass-through could fit bulkier items, and there were multiple cupholders and storage options. The second-row captain's chairs could slide 25 inches, providing up to 40 inches of legroom. However, the slide function was complicated, and the seats could not be removed, limiting maximum cargo space.

The third row was accessible and offered ample legroom when the second row was adjusted. The Sienna featured tri-zone climate control, with an additional zone for the front passenger in the XSE trim. The rear liftgate, activated by a kick motion, revealed 33.5 cubic feet of cargo space, expandable to 75 cubic feet with the third row stowed and 101 cubic feet with the second row folded.

Technology

2023 Buick Encore GX

8/10

2024 Toyota Sienna

6/10

The 2023 Buick Encore GX came with a standard 8-inch touchscreen and a 4.2-inch driver information display. Optional features included a built-in navigation system, head-up display, wireless phone charging, and an eight-speaker Bose audio system. Standard tech included wireless Apple CarPlay and Android Auto, Bluetooth, a Wi-Fi hotspot, and SiriusXM satellite radio. The interface was user-friendly, with clear graphics and easy-to-navigate menus.

The 2024 Toyota Sienna, unfortunately, retained Toyota's older infotainment system, featuring a nine-inch touchscreen with wired Apple CarPlay and Android Auto. While the system included physical buttons for common menus, the backup camera's grainy view was disappointing. The Sienna had a 7-inch digital display in the instrument cluster and offered a Wi-Fi hotspot, SiriusXM satellite radio, and an optional 12-speaker JBL stereo system. USB ports were plentiful, and a 1500-watt inverter with a 120-volt outlet was available. Optional features included an 11.6-inch rear-seat entertainment system and a 10-inch color head-up display.

Safety

2023 Buick Encore GX

9/10

2024 Toyota Sienna

8/10

The 2023 Buick Encore GX included standard driver assist features like automatic emergency braking, forward collision warning, lane keep assist, lane departure warning, automatic high beams, and a Teen Driver system. Optional features included adaptive cruise control, automatic park assist, blind spot monitoring, rear cross traffic alert, a 360-degree camera system, and a rearview camera mirror. The Encore GX received a five-star overall safety rating from the NHTSA and was an IIHS 2022 Top Safety Pick.

The 2024 Toyota Sienna came standard with the Toyota Safety Sense suite, including lane departure alert, automatic emergency braking, road sign recognition, full-speed adaptive cruise control, and automatic high beams. Blind-spot monitoring and rear cross-traffic alert were also standard. The Sienna had numerous airbags, a seat belt reminder for rear passengers, and a reminder to check the rear seats for cargo or passengers. The Sienna received a four-star rating for frontal crash and rollover protection and a five-star rating for side crash protection from the NHTSA. The IIHS rated it "Good" in crashworthiness and seat belt and child restraint systems, but "Average" in front crash prevention.

According to CarGurus experts, the overall rating for the 2023 Buick Encore GX is 6.7 out of 10, while the 2024 Toyota Sienna scores 7.5 out of 10. Based on these ratings, the 2024 Toyota Sienna is the better choice, offering more space, better safety features, and a higher overall rating.
